The Learning Geeks podcast is dedicated to those that passionately support the world in experiencing better learning. The podcast is hosted by three learning professionals - Bob Gerard, Dana Koch, and Jake Gittleson. Focused on enhancing learning experiences, this podcast engages with topics relevant to education, corporate training, and personal development. The episodes discuss current trends and technologies in learning, such as artificial intelligence and cognitive science, while offering insights from a range of guests, including industry leaders and educators. Notably, the hosts blend humor with practical advice, helping listeners navigate the evolving landscape of learning methodologies and instructional design. With elements of storytelling and pop culture references, the content is tailored for anyone interested in the future of education and effective learning practices.
